Meet Jennifer

Jennifer has a Master of Science in Acupuncture.  She studied at Southwest Acupuncture College in Boulder, Colorado and completed her National Board Certification in Acupuncture with the National Certification Committee for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ine (NCCAOM) in 2014 and is licensed to practice in the state of Arizona. This type of training includes 3 1/2  years of study and nearly 3,000 hours of master level training. 
 
Jennifer specializes in the following:​​
  • Pain Management
  • Women's Health
  • Microneedling  
  • Facial Rejuvenation (cosmetic acupuncture)  
  • Ophthalmic Acupuncture for Vision Disorders
   
She also ear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in Hospitality Management from Metro State University at Denver, Colorado and worked for years as a Consultant for the State Board of Education, at the Colorado Department of Education prior to returning to graduate school in Boulder, Colora.

How to Prepare for Your Appointment

  • Arrive early to check in
  • Your first visit allow extra time for paperwork and intake
  • Wear comfortable, loose fitting clothing
  • Have a light snack or meal at least 15 minutes before your visit
  • Turn off your cell phone so you and others can relax
